Hey all

My 11.5 month old has willy-nilly started to refuse breastfeeds. We were at the stage where my DH feeds her a bottle (expressed milk) in the morning and I breastfeed her at night before bed. However the last two nights (and this morning just to see) she doesn't want to know me, basically doesn't suck and just starts spitting my nipple out, or worse, biting me, really hard!! We've then bottle fed her and she'll guzzle 200mls so I know she's hungry.

So, do you reckon she's self-weaning? Is it normally as sudden as that? She's always been such a "booby-baby" its weird that its a big fat no all of a sudden. I was planning on stopping at one year so its not the end of the world I guess.

Also if this is the end of it, I don't think I'll be able to express enough for two whole feeds a day so do I bother with formula or go straight to cows milk?

Just wondering what others' experiences have been or if you have any advice?

She's also just cut her fifth tooth - not sure if this has made a difference too?

TIA!!

Could be teething? Or a random nursing strike. DS went through this at around 6 months, but after a few days and lots of perseverance he went back to being the milk lover he always was.
